Can you please elaborate? So, html will not be available for those who DO NOT use exchange? How about PUSH services like mail2web and emoze?.

No I just meant for exchange sync... HTML e-mail should work fine with POP and IMAP servers... not sure about Hotmail (via Windows Live).

Mail2web (not sure bout emoze) is Exchange 2003, so no HTML e-mail through them. I believe they plan to upgrade to 2007 later this year.

Nope it's not... Why did you edit the default value? First of all open that up and clear it out so it shows nothing next to that.

Create a new string value and name it "Path" (no quotes). Don't set the value to anything--just leave it blank. Then exit out of the reg editor, suspend your device and wake it a couple of times (this ensures that your edits get saved to flash). Then soft reset the phone. Your button 5 should work after that.

To stop the SUCCESS: text message confirmation do this regedit:
Edit the registry

HKLM\SOFTWARE\OEM\SMS

Change "Delivery Ack" from 1 to 0

Soft reset
